首先,我希望这次我发帖的地方是对的。如果我问的问题不适合这个论坛,请不要太过责备我。
我创建了一个装有 Ubuntu 14.04.01 的 USB 启动盘。我试图将它安装在 2013 年 11 月购买的 Zoostorm 台式机上 - Zoostorm 台式电脑、AMD Elite DC A4-5300 3.4GHz、4GB RAM、500GB HDD、DVDRW、AMD HD 7480D、Windows 8.1。
基本上,我无法在其上安装 Ubuntu 或从启动 USB 运行 Ubuntu 超过几秒钟/几分钟(昨天是几分钟,今天是几秒钟)。以下是我目前遇到的问题和尝试过的方法(我尽量不遗漏任何内容,以防万一有人知道):
- 重要提示:在我尝试安装 Ubuntu 之前,新机器一直运行 Windows 8,没有任何问题。运行 Windows 8 时,无论是硬件还是其他方面,都没有出现任何问题。
- 由于昨天 Ubuntu 安装出现以下问题,安装过程中机器重新启动,导致 Windows 8 分区损坏,无法修复/恢复。我希望让机器实现双启动。
- 虽然我不是 Ubuntu 专家,但我过去曾设置过许多 Ubuntu 安装(从 Ubuntu 6 开始 - 那是很久以前的事情了,我不太清楚具体数字),大多数是与 Windows 双启动,但有些只是 Ubuntu。我已经设置并安装了 Ubuntu 台式机、笔记本电脑和服务器。我习惯于费力地让无线驱动程序等在笔记本电脑上运行,所以我熟悉困难的安装和设置。
- 到目前为止,我已经花了超过 14 个小时尝试在这台机器上安装 Ubuntu。
- 我尝试使用 2 个不同的 USB 驱动器进行以下操作
- 我已多次在 USB 驱动器上重新创建了 USB 映像。
- 我已经运行“检查磁盘是否存在缺陷”。
- 昨天,我无法从 USB 运行 Ubuntu(“尝试不安装的 Ubuntu”)超过几分钟,然后机器就会自行重启。
- 今天,在机器重新启动之前,我只能看到“试用 Ubuntu”桌面几秒钟。今天机器重新启动时,我短暂地看到右下角的数字“92”几秒钟,然后是另一个数字(太快了,看不清),然后是 D7(在黑屏上,白色文字,屏幕上没有其他内容)。我不知道这是什么意思,也不知道我为什么会看到它。在这次自动重启之后,我发现当它再次进入 Ubuntu 启动菜单时,鼠标和键盘已经停止工作(都是 USB)。我必须关闭机器电源并重新启动,它们才能再次工作。
- 昨天,我能够启动到“试用 Ubuntu”桌面并从那里开始安装。但是,在完成 Ubuntu 安装选项后,机器每次都会自动重启到不同的地方,有时是在我选择安装选项时,有时是在 Ubuntu 开始安装/格式化后。
- 如果我选择现在从启动菜单安装 Ubuntu,我会短暂地看到 Ubuntu 徽标,然后屏幕变黑,几秒钟后机器会自动重启
- 我尝试打开 BIOS 的 Windows 8 部分,也尝试关闭所有 Windows 8 启动功能(包括关闭快速启动)。
- 我已尝试过 3 个不同的硬盘。
有谁对我还可以尝试什么或其他哪些信息可能有帮助有什么想法或建议吗?
谢谢。
答案1
nomodeset
我最终通过向 Live USB 启动菜单添加如下选项,将 Ubuntu 安装在 Zoostorm 上:
- 在启动屏幕上按e
- 找到行结尾
quiet splash
并nodemodeset
在其前面添加。 - 按下F10以启动(对于我来说,在按下之前我已经选择了安装前尝试e)
- 从桌面选择安装 Ubuntu。(如果您从启动菜单中选择安装 Ubuntu,这可能也会起作用,但我还没有尝试过)。
- 等待安装,然后选择“立即重启”。(注意:安装过程中我的屏幕变黑,但按“任意键”即可刷新屏幕 - 看起来像屏幕保护程序空白屏幕或类似的东西)。
- 然后机器重新启动,我看到了 Ubuntu 加载徽标。不久之后,机器再次重新启动。通过再次打开和关闭机器来重新启动机器,并按住shift以确保看到 grub 启动菜单。
- 在 Ubuntu 启动菜单中e再次按并重复步骤 2 和 3。
- 然后您应该启动并进入 Ubuntu 安装。
- 现在,您需要永久修改内核启动参数(除非您要尝试找到正确的视频驱动程序)。为此,我安装了 Grub Customizer,如下所示这些说明。从 Grub Customizer 中选择“General settings”选项卡,在“quiet splash”前的内核参数中输入“nomodeset”。然后点击“Save”按钮。
下次重新启动并检查您是否登录到 Ubuntu,而无需机器自行重新启动。
我在看的时候有了上述想法Ubuntu 论坛这篇文章.根据这篇文章:
添加 nomodeset 参数指示内核在 X 加载之前不加载视频驱动程序,而是使用 BIOS 模式。